Ok, here is the story.
I have recently done an engine conversion in my 94 EF falcon. (this engine has 75K less klms than my original).
After a couple of days it started to have a little bit of blue smoke on start up. This smoke would stop after about 500m or so of driving. So that led me to believe that maybe the valve stems are shot. Note: It doesn't smoke all the time. (This engine is so much more powerful than my last.)
So i went to autobahn and got me some of that Wynn's "stop smoke". This has made the problem 100 times worse. There is more smoke, for a little bit longer, but its not blue???
This has me well and truly stumped.
So what i want to know is:
1 Would my rings & stem seals need replacing
2 Can this be done by myself and my grand dad over a weekend. (any one else done this???)
3 If we cant do it, how much would it cost me to get this done at a mechanic. (any one know of a good mechanic in the sunny coast area?)

| hi matey a trick taught to me from an old mechanic to see if it your valve stem seals ,is to drive down a moerate hill an pull ya foot off the throttle an have some in your car to watch an see if any smoke comes out the exhaust, if you blue smoke while doing this ya valve stem seals have seen better days |
